What do great athletes and great leaders have in common? The best ones never stop learning. For nearly three decades,Damon Lembi has ledLearnit, a global training company that has helped 1.8 million professionals upskill and stay ahead in their careers. But before he became a bestselling author and CEO, he was an aspiring pro baseball player - until life threw him a curveball.

Instead of stepping onto the field, he found himself stepping into business, facing imposter syndrome, navigating the highs and lows of leadership, and discovering a game-changing mindset: The Learn-It-All Mentality.

Now, as the author of The Learn-It-All Leader, Damon helps executives, entrepreneurs, and teams cultivate the skills they need to thrive. He believes that in today's fast-paced world, the most successful people aren’t the ones who “know it all” but the ones who stay curious, adaptable, and willing to learn.
